1) to open wide, gape 1a) (Qal) to gape
STRONG'S WORD STUDY
H6473 — פָּעַר
pa.ar · to open · Hebrew/Aramaic
4 tagged verse occurrences
Job 16:10 · פָּעֲר֬וּThey have gaped on me with their mouth. They have struck me on the cheek reproachfully. They gather themselves together against me.Job 29:23 · פָּעֲר֥וּThey waited for me as for the rain. Their mouths drank as with the spring rain.Psalm 119:131 · פָ֭עַרְתִּיI opened my mouth wide and panted, for I longed for your commandments.Isaiah 5:14 · וּפָעֲרָ֥הTherefore Sheol has enlarged its desire, and opened its mouth without measure; and their glory, their multitude, their pomp, and he who rejoices among them, descend into it.
